Altice USA, a leading cable operator in the United States this week launched Altice Mobile service, offering unlimited plans for as low as $20 per line per month for its Optimum and Suddenlink customers.
Altice Mobile is also available to non-Optimum and Suddenlink customers who live in or near the company’s 21-state footprint, including throughout New York City, for $30 per line per month.
Altice's mobile plan includes unlimited talk, text, data and unlimited international talk and text to 35 destinations and international roaming in those same countries. It also includes unlimited hotspot usage and video streaming in standard definition.
Altice Mobile delivers advanced LTE coverage by combining Altice's own fiber and mobile core infrastructure. Altice Mobile said it will also evolve to include new wireless technologies, including 5G.
